1. Fruit Ninja HD:

The first one on our list is Fruit Ninja created by Halfbrick. This pick contains a lot of hi-paced action especially when you play against another player in the split-screen mode. The gameplay is also fun and simple as you just need to swipe your fingers across any fruit that jumps into your screen.

Fruit Ninja HD

You can fight against many opponents to prove to them that you have what it takes to become the ultimate fighting ninja. So if you have become an expert fruit dicer you have a chance to show off all your skills to your friends. There are also two modes offered to you out here namely the Zen mode and Classic Attack, each of them have their own unique challenges.

2. Mirror’s Edge:

Here is another neat game that you can play especially if you own an iPad. Mirrors Edge is all about high-speed running action, as you play as a female runner who is skilled in running across rooftops of high rises and incapacitating hostile guards of an oppressive government with deadly flying kicks and slides.

Mirror's Edge

Your fun gets even more intense out here when you play against other runners in the two player mode. You and your opponent can battle in split-screen to see who the better runner is by taking part in races on the special Race Maps. The moves of your character as pretty easy to control as you just need to match your finger swiping to the momentum of your runner and watch as she zooms past obstacles with ease.

3. Flight Control HD:

The third option which we can recommend for you is Flight Control HD developed by Firemint. This particular game puts you in charge of the safe landing of all the aircrafts that enter into your airport to make a landing on your runways or helipads.

Flight Control HD

- Advertisements -

Your gameplay gets very exciting once you find dozens of aircrafts coming to land from all over the place. You can even take the help of a friend to land the planes in case the traffic get overwhelming or you can even try the versus mode and see who can truly handle the job of an air traffic controller.

4. TowerMadness HD:

How can we leave out TowerMadness HD on our lineup for all you tower defense lovers? Here you will be battling all-out alien invasions that have only one objective in mind i.e. stealing all of your sheep. Luckily you will get tons of gun towers that you can set-up against your alien nemesis and then watch as they blow them to smithereens.

TowerMadness HD

And if you wanted some additional excitement, then that is what the local multiplayer option is there for. You can enjoy endless hours of alien zapping entertainment along with your friend and even release the lethal sheep snatching RoboSteal character that can steal the sheep’s of your adversary.

5. Worms 2: Armageddon

Want to try a game with a lot more explosive action? Then Worms 2: Armageddon should be just what you were looking for. Here will get to use some of the greatest weapons to completely devastate your opponents in action-packed player vs. player gaming modes.

Worms 2: Armageddon

This one allows up to four players to play a match at one time and since this is mostly turn-based, each player with get a chance to do some real damage against enemy worms. You can take your pick from a variety of weapons ranging from bazookas to hand grenades and even some unconventional ones like exploding sheep and homing pigeons.

6. SkyWords:

If you have played the classic Scrabble board game, then playing SkyWords would be no problem for you. The objectives would be the same, i.e. you have to score by making words from the letters you have available to you.

SkyWords

- Advertisements -

But the unique twist of this pick is that to can stack more letters on top of an existing word to make a new one. This innovative gameplay allows you to use your opponent’s words to your advantage and make your own. With the Pass and Play feature, you can easily play with up to 4 different players at a time.

7. Hangman Pro:

This pick is probably known to everyone who has played the traditional pencil and paper version of Hangman. Only difference is now you will get to play on a digital platform of your iPad or iPhone and even battle with other players to check whose vocabulary is more refined.

Hangman Pro

Hangman Pro allows you to set the gaming difficulty and even choose from a whole range of different topics that are available such as animal, countries, food etc.

8. TraceWord:

And the last one we can mention on this roster is TraceWord made by Native Cloud Systems. Here you basically need to uncover the words that are hidden in a given word jumble. To make your job a bit easier, the words will be given to you and all you need to do is trace them as they will be in the horizontal, vertical, diagonal or even forward or backwards direction.

TraceWord

Your gameplay will get trickier when you have to face other opponents who are on the same level as you, as you have to beat them by catching all of the hidden words before they do.
